A couple of months ago I did a post on our President’s much vaunted honesty and integrity. He’s called Mai Gaskiya on account of his inability to lie. He’s truthful to a fault and that in itself is a plus. Based on these attributes he was voted in and one of his latest sobriquet is the Sheriff. He came in to clean the augean corruption stables. The new Sheriff is in town and we must all fall in line. But saying the truth is subjective. Nigeria is corrupt no doubt but are we any more corrupt than other nations? Even as we are corrupt our Chief Marketing Officer is duty bound to draw positive attention to the brand we are selling.

Now Buhari is the Chief Executive Officer of Nigeria. He’s also the Chief Marketing Officer. Nigeria is the product which must be sold. His job description first and foremost is SELL THE BRAND! While campaigning he shouted corruption to the highest heavens. The previous government was painted as inept and popular opinion turned against him. Even people who had gained individually and collectively turned on him. All for the new battle cry.

Now Buhari is president and I personally don’t understand his style of governance. First he never speaks to his people. Any pronouncement we hear, we hear from foreign media. And every pronouncement is a negative indictment of his product. Every nation he goes to (which by the way is quite plenty), he sings dirges about his product. His product is flawed, his product is corrupt, bad, inept and of no use. He demarkets the very product he’s been employed to sell and there seems no end in sight.

Buhari calls his lieutenants noisemakers and says they are of no import. After a rigmarole of nearly 6 months he’s yet to conclude on the cabinet of noisemakers or assign noise making portfolios to them. He says some will not have portfolios and may have to work without pay. And in the most uncharacteristic twist in Nigeria these people actually agree to serve for free. There’s a sudden new found altruistic love of nation and I laugh out loud!

Buhari’s aides need to sit up and teach Mai Gaskiya how to comport himself on international speaking. No one goes about demarketing his product. In the business world he will get an outright sack and though this is politics, it is the business of managing Nigeria. Diplomatese insists we sell ourselves right. And of a truth Nigeria is a lovely country which needs proper management and maintenance. When the President of a nation sees nothing good in his country except to sing corruption at the tiniest opportunity who then in the world will call us otherwise?

If the Chief Marketing Officer thinks his product is flawed and can’t be remedied, then he should quietly hand over to one who though has a flawed product is willing to make it work.

We really can’t go on like this. Something’s gotta give and soon too.
